Title: Passive Tracers in a Slowly Decorrelating Random Velocity Field

Abstract: In random media transport of large-scale physical parameters may occur on different time scales. This can arise due to long-range correlations in the media. We illustrate it on a simple example of a particle advected by a random row $V$. if $V$ is slowly decorrelating, then the large-scale long-time asymptotic behavior of the particle may be described by a fractional Brownian motion on a slow time-scale, whereas the distance between two particles has diffusive behavior on an even slower time-scale.
